#ifndef RTP_SINK_H_
#define RTP_SINK_H_
#include <media/stagefright/foundation/AHandler.h>
#include "LinearRegression.h"
#include <gui/Surface.h>
namespace android {
struct ABuffer;
struct ANetworkSession;
struct TunnelRenderer;
// Creates a pair of sockets for RTP/RTCP traffic, instantiates a renderer
// for incoming transport stream data and occasionally sends statistics over
// the RTCP channel.
struct RTPSink : public AHandler {
RTPSink(const sp<ANetworkSession> &netSession);
// If TCP interleaving is used, no UDP sockets are created, instead
// incoming RTP/RTCP packets (arriving on the RTSP control connection)
// are manually injected by WifiDisplaySink.
status_t init(bool useTCPInterleaving);
status_t connect(
const char *host, int32_t remoteRtpPort, int32_t remoteRtcpPort);
int32_t getRTPPort() const;
status_t injectPacket(bool isRTP, const sp<ABuffer> &buffer);
TunnelRenderer* getRender(){return mRenderer.get();};
void Processdata(sp<ABuffer> &data,int sessionId);
void clear_mNetSession(); // for resolve the sp problem modify by lance 2013.06.01
int32_t get_mRTPSessionID() const; // add by lance for get mRTPSessionID 2013.06.01
int32_t get_mRTCPSessionID() const; // add by lance for get mRTCPSessionID 2013.06.01
sp<ANetworkSession>& get_mNetSession(); // add by lance for getting mNetSession 2013.06.01
protected:
virtual void onMessageReceived(const sp<AMessage> &msg);
virtual ~RTPSink();
private:
enum {
kWhatRTPNotify,
kWhatRTCPNotify,
kWhatSendRR,
kWhatPacketLost,
kWhatInject,
};
struct Source;
struct StreamSource;
sp<ANetworkSession> mNetSession;
KeyedVector<uint32_t, sp<Source> > mSources;
int32_t mRTPPort;
int32_t mRTPSessionID;
int32_t mRTCPSessionID;
int64_t mFirstArrivalTimeUs;
int64_t mNumPacketsReceived;
LinearRegression mRegression;
int64_t mMaxDelayMs;
sp<TunnelRenderer> mRenderer;
sp<ALooper> renderLooper;
status_t parseRTP(const sp<ABuffer> &buffer);
status_t parseRTCP(const sp<ABuffer> &buffer);
status_t parseBYE(const uint8_t *data, size_t size);
status_t parseSR(const uint8_t *data, size_t size);
void addSDES(const sp<ABuffer> &buffer);
void onSendRR();
void onPacketLost(const sp<AMessage> &msg);
void scheduleSendRR();
DISALLOW_EVIL_CONSTRUCTORS(RTPSink);
};
} // namespace android
#endif // RTP_SINK_H_
